Hi.  My name is Leah and I am a diabetic.  Type II.  Let me start this out by saying if you've ever been warned about "syndrome X" or "prediabetes"  . . . HEED THE WARNINGS!!  I didn't and here I am.  I was gestationally diabetic with my 2nd child back in 2000.  The doctors warned me that I now had an increased chance of becoming diabetic later in life if I didn't change my eating habits and my lack of exercise.    If I could turn back time . . .

I was just put on an insulin regimen two weeks ago.  I am so tired of this already and struggle some days with remembering everything I have to do before I can eat.  I am sure, unfortunately, at some point it will become a habit.  My goal is to get my self back under control before it's had too much of a chance to be the norm.

I'm sure I will have some ups and downs along the way and I learned years ago when my Dad was sick that writing is a good outlet for me.  So, with this recent bump in my life I decided it was time to write again.
